The Vedas are a collection of ancient sacred texts in Hinduism. They are considered the oldest scriptures of Hinduism and are highly revered as divine revelations.
holy Vedas were originally commandments of God to first men. Vedas are used as guidance for daily life in Hinduism. Vedas are also used for religious activities and rituals.
Yes, Hinduism is the Indian religion that stresses belief in the Vedas. The Vedas are ancient texts considered to be sacred in Hinduism and are foundational to many Hindu beliefs and practices.

Vedas are ancient religious texts in Hinduism, while Sanskrit is the language in which the Vedas were originally composed. Sanskrit is an ancient Indo-European language and is considered sacred in Hinduism, often used for religious and philosophical texts like the Vedas.
